Use leftover pulled pork to make this hearty breakfast – it will keep you fueled all morning long!

1 pkg | Southeastern Mills® Peppered Gravy Mix |
8 | frozen pancakes |
2 cup | pulled pork, warmed |
4 | thinly sliced red onion rounds, separated |
4 | egg, fried |
2 Tbsp | finely chopped fresh parsley |
Prepare Peppered Gravy Mix according to package directions. Reheat pancakes according to package directions.
Divide pancakes among 4 plates. Top with pulled pork, red onion and fried egg. Drizzle each serving with 1/4 cup gravy and sprinkle with parsley.
Substitute Canadian bacon, bacon strips or breakfast sausage for pulled pork. Add remaining gravy to soups or tomato sauce for a creamy finish.
